Kirksey v. Oriental Trading Company Inc.
Plaintiff: Keith Kirksey
Defendant: Oriental Trading Company Inc.
Case Number: 8:2024cv00268
Filed: July 2, 2024
Court: U.S. District Court for the District of Nebraska
Presiding Judge: Jacqueline M DeLuca
Referring Judge: Robert F Rossiter
Nature of Suit: Civil Rights: Jobs
Cause of Action: 42 U.S.C. ยง 2000 e Job Discrimination (Employment)
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ff
